    US judge rejects Trump team’s bid to move Mahmoud Khalil case to Louisiana | Courts News

    Ruling is seen as a win for Khalil however doesn’t assure he shall be moved out of the detention facility within the southern state of Louisiana.

    A United States federal court docket choose has dominated in favour of pro-Palestinian activist Mahmoud Khalil, permitting him to problem the legality of his arrest in New Jersey moderately than in Louisiana, the place he’s being held at a detention facility with out fees.

    The choice by US District Decide Michael Farbiarz on Tuesday marked the second time the President Donald Trump administration’s legal team was unsuccessful in transferring the Columbia College scholar’s case over to the fifth US Circuit Courtroom of Appeals in Louisiana – the nation’s most conservative appeals court docket – to get Khalil deported.

    Khalil’s lawyer, Baher Azmy, mentioned his crew was grateful the court docket understood the federal government’s “clear try” to control the jurisdiction of US courts to defend their “unconstitutional” and “chilling” behaviour.

    Dr Noor Abdalla, Khalil’s pregnant spouse who’s a US citizen, mentioned she was relieved by the choice however that “there may be nonetheless much more to be carried out”, to launch Khalil, whose green card was revoked by US authorities.

    Though Tuesday’s case was a win for Khalil, it solely settled the jurisdictional dispute of which court docket would be capable of hear his makes an attempt to problem the legality of the Trump administration’s efforts to deport him – a dispute that originated when Khalil was held in a New Jersey detention facility for a number of hours following his arrest in Manhattan on March 8, earlier than being moved throughout state strains to Louisiana.

    Khalil’s case is seen as a take a look at of Trump’s efforts to deport pro-Palestinian activists who haven’t been charged with any crime.

    The Trump administration mentioned it has revoked the visas of a whole lot of international college students it says took half in demonstrations that swept faculty campuses throughout the US, protesting towards the federal government’s army assist for Israel’s warfare on Gaza.

    Legal professionals say the Trump administration has improperly focused folks for holding specific political opinions.

    Khalil’s attorneys have additionally requested Decide Farbiarz to launch their consumer from detention in Louisiana as efforts to deport him in a separate case earlier than an immigration court docket play out and, partly, to permit him to be along with his spouse for the beginning of their son.

    A health care provider’s letter filed in court docket estimates that the child is due on April 28.
